Cleaning module and autonomous cleaning device
Abstract
The present application relates to the field of cleaning device, and more particularly to a cleaning module and an autonomous cleaning device. The cleaning module providing with the first dust-passing opening, the second mounting frame is provided with the second dust-passing opening; by arranging the air duct, and the two ends of the air duct are respectively connected to the first dust-passing opening and the second dust-passing opening sealingly, the first mounting frame is configured to be connected to the machine body, and the second mounting frame is configured to be connected to the roller brush.

1 . A cleaning module, comprising:
a first mounting frame, proving with a first dust-passing opening; a second mounting frame, proving with a second dust-passing opening, wherein the second mounting frame is connected to the first mounting frame; the first mounting frame is configured to be connected to a machine body, and the second mounting frame is connected to a roller brush; and an air duct, a first end of the air duct being in a sealed connection with the first dust-passing opening, and a second end of the air duct being in a detachable and sealed connection with the second dust-passing opening.
2 . The cleaning module according to claim 1 , wherein the air duct is an elastic air duct.
3 . The cleaning module according to claim 2 , wherein the first mounting frame is further provided with:
a connection plate, the first dust-passing opening is arranged on the connection plate; and a frame body, provided with an opening for receiving the first end, and the connection plate is detachably connected with the frame body.
4 . The cleaning module according to claim 3 , wherein the first end of the air duct is hot-melted to the connection plate at the first dust-passing opening to form a sealed connection between the first end and the first dust-passing opening.
5 . The cleaning module according to claim 3 , wherein one of the connection plate and the frame body is provided with a first connection portion, and the other of the connection plate and the frame body is provided with a second connection portion, and the first connection portion and the second connection portion cooperate with each other, such that the connection plate is detachably connected to the frame body.
6 . The cleaning module according to claim 5 , wherein the first connection portion is configured to be a protrusion, the second connection portion is configured to be a groove adapted to the protrusion, and the protrusion is inserted into the groove to form a detachable connection between the connection plate and the frame body.
7 . The cleaning module according to claim 6 , wherein the opening is configured to be a stepped opening, the connection plate is fitted with the opening, and an opening direction of the groove is the same as an opening direction of the opening, such that the connection plate is able to slide along the opening direction of the opening until the groove is inserted into the protrusion.
8 . The cleaning module according to claim 5 , wherein at least one side of the opening is provided with the first connection portion, and at least one side of the connection plate corresponding to the opening is provided with the second connection portion.
9 . The cleaning module according to claim 1 , wherein an opening length of the second end of the air duct is smaller than an opening length of the first end of the air duct, such that an airflow path with a gradual opening length is formed.
10 . The cleaning module according to claim 9 , wherein the second dust-passing opening is in a strip shape, and the second dust-passing opening extends from one end to an other end of the second mounting frame in a length direction of the second mounting frame, and the second end of the air duct is adapted to the second dust-passing opening.
11 . The cleaning module according to claim 1 , wherein the second mounting frame is provided with a boss, and the second dust-passing opening is arranged on the boss;
the cleaning module further comprises a connection frame, and the connection frame is detachably connected to the boss; and the second end of the air duct is provided with an elastic gasket, and the elastic gasket is sealingly arranged between the boss and the connection frame to form a sealed connection between the second end of the air duct and the second dust-passing opening.
12 . The cleaning module according to claim 11 , wherein the second end of the air duct extends in a direction away from a center of the air duct to form the elastic gasket.
13 . The cleaning module according to claim 12 , wherein one of the boss and the connection frame is provided with a protrusion portion, the other of the boss and the connection frame is provided with a through hole, and the protrusion portion and the through hole cooperate with each other, such that the connection frame and the boss are detachably connected.
14 . An autonomous cleaning device, comprising a cleaning module, and the cleaning module being arranged on a machine body, wherein the cleaning module comprises:
a first mounting frame, proving with a first dust-passing opening; a second mounting frame, proving with a second dust-passing opening, wherein the second mounting frame is connected to the first mounting frame; the first mounting frame is configured to be connected to the machine body, and the second mounting frame is connected to a roller brush; and an air duct, a first end of the air duct being in a sealed connection with the first dust-passing opening, and a second end of the air duct being in a detachable and sealed connection with the second dust-passing opening.
